在C语言的if语句中,用作判断的表达式为 A. 算术表达式 B. 逻辑表达式 C. 关系表达式 D. 任意表达式 如果不加花括号表示else与if的配对关系,则e
在C语言中,0被视为假,而非0被视为真。因此,如果表达式的值为0,那么if语句块内的代码将不会被执行;如果表达式的值非0,那么if语句块内的代码将被执行。例如,以下是一个判断一个整数是否为奇数的简单例子:```c #include int main() { int num; scanf("%d", &num); if (num % 2 == 1) { printf...
if 语句使用,输入成绩判断等级#C语言从零开始 #if的使用方法 - 徐海磊哥(杨老师)于20241013发布在抖音,已经收获了9.8万个喜欢,来抖音,记录美好生活!
解析:由于code=3,大于0,所以 if 语句的条件code<=0不满足,所以就会跳过 if 语言,而 else总是和最近的那个 if 匹配,并且与缩进无关,所以这个else是与 if (count<20)匹配,不是与 if (code<=0)匹配。 3.3 用 if else 语句来表示分段函数 if( x < 0 ){f = -1;}else if( x == 0){f = 0;}...
if是条件判断语句,只有if的条件成立(表达式的值为真)后,才会执行if部分的代码,否则将会执行else的代码。 如果是if...else if,则满足第一个if执行第一个if里的代码,如果不满足第一个if,而满足第二个if,则执行第二个if(即else if)的代码,如果都不满足,就不执行 ...
if语句中用作判断的表达式可以是任何返回值为真或假的表达式。这些表达式可以是关系表达式(比如大于、小于、等于等),逻辑表达式(比如与、或、非等),或者其他返回布尔值的函数调用。 例如,一个简单的if语句可以是这样的: c. int x = 10; if (x > 5) {。 // 如果x大于5,则执行这里的代码。 printf("x...
1、if-else判断语句 一个基本的if语句由一个关键字if开头,跟上在括号()里边的是表示逻辑条件的表达式,然后是一对大括号{}中间是若干条语句,如果条件的逻辑表达式的结果不是零,那么就执行大括号中间的语句,否则就跳过不执行。 if的返回值为真或假,可以用bool型变量进行存储,占用一字节。
C语言的if判断语句格式如下 #include<stdio.h>voidmain(){inti; printf("\n请输入您想要判断的值\n"); scanf("%d",&i);if(i>=10){/*if是判断语句,括号内的是条件*/printf("您输入的值大于或者等于10");/*如果满足条件,输出这一个,结束if判断*/}else{/*如果判断的值不满足判断条件,就执行else*...
1在C语言的if语句中,用作判断的表达式为 A.算术表达式 B.逻辑表达式 C.关系表达式 D.任意表达式 如果不加花括号表示else与if的配对关系,则else与if的匹配方法是 A.else与它上面最远的if配对 B.else与它上面最近的if配对 C.else与离它最近的if配对 D.else与它上面最近的且没有和其他else配对的if配对 函数...
intmain(){inta =10;intb =5;intc = a > b ? a : b;printf("%d", c);return0; } 到此,条件判断语句就差不多了 0x02.JCC指令与IF语句反汇编 1、案例一 mov eax, dword ptr[ebp + 8] 分析:cmp指令 影响标志位 cmp eax, dword ptr[ebp + 0Ch] jle :小于或者等于就跳转到00401059 ...